Utraura is a village in Asoha block of Unnao district, Uttar Pradesh, India.[2] It is not located on major district roads and has one primary school and no healthcare facilities.[2] As of 2011, its population is 1,281, in 281 households.[2]

The 1961 census recorded Utraura as comprising 2 hamlets, with a total population of 997 (522 male and 475 female), in 102 households and 92 physical houses.[3] The area of the village was given as 582 acres.[3] It had one small manufacturer of textiles as well as a small establishment classified as making jewellery or precious metal items.[3]
